Item of the Month for June: Canned Beans

As you know, we have a Full Choice model at the Food Pantry, where our clients can choose items that best fulfill the needs of their household. We buy food in bulk from the Westchester Food Bank, but not all the items we’d like to offer are always available.

With the full choice model we have learned that our clients are more likely to choose canned or dried beans than other high-protein foods such as peanut butter. One of the advantages of the full choice model is gaining this sort of insight into the best way to provide a “balanced selection” for our clients.

When we suggest an “item of the month,” it’s not just some suggestion from a rotating calendar, it’s actually something that has not been easily available from Feeding Westchester.

Noting the item of the month and bringing in some supplies can help the pantry offer as wide a variety of foods as possible. There are donation bins behind the Christian Education building.
